In this form of legal system, the term private international law does not imply an agreed upon international legal corpus , but rather refers to those portions of domestic private law that apply to international issues. SUBJECTS:- The two major systems of law, the common law and the civil law, differ from each other as to the subject-matter of private international law. Civil Law Countries: Few countries for example Germany restrict the scope of private international law to problems of conflict of laws, and matters relating to status of foreigners fall under separate branch called the law of foreigners while few others like Soviet Union include within its ambit the rules of choice of law along with all the Anything between 2 people (or legal persons) can fall under private law. For example family law, commercial arbitration, company law. Anything that involves a state-level entity usually falls under public law.

The branch of law which deals with cases of private law involving a foreign element (as the fulfilment of contracts, recognition of marriages and other relationships contracted abroad, etc.), especially in determining the extent to which courts of one's own country have jurisdiction over such cases and whether the domestic or foreign law should be applied by the court to resolving the issue. 2021-02-23
Public international law refers to all the legal rules governing international relations between public entities such as States and international organizations. In order to settle a public international law dispute, it is the International Court of Justice (ICJ) sitting …

2013-08-02 · Private international law is the body of conventions, model laws, national laws, legal guides, and other documents and instruments that regulate private relationships across national borders.
